Now officially open on Paradise Island in Nassau, Bahamas, Royal Caribbean’s Royal Beach Club is already redefining what a beach day in port can look like. Just a short and scenic water taxi ride from the cruise terminal, this 17-acre retreat blends laid-back luxury with the vibrant culture and beauty of The Bahamas.
It’s not just another beach stop. It’s a thoughtfully designed experience that makes it easy to relax, explore, and enjoy the best of island life without the stress of planning transportation, finding seating, or navigating crowded public beaches.
The beach club is divided into three distinct zones, making it easy for every type of traveler to find their perfect spot for the day.

When your cruise includes one of these private stops, my advice is simple: treat it as an all-day event. The beauty of these destinations is that you can come and go at your own pace without worrying about transportation or timing.
For couples or parents looking for a touch of luxury, a cabana or daybed can be a worthwhile splurge. Having a comfortable home base with food and drink service makes the day feel even more relaxing.
The biggest reason I recommend Royal Caribbean’s private destinations is peace of mind. You don’t have to worry about navigating unfamiliar cities, arranging transportation, or keeping track of complex schedules. Everything is designed to be close, convenient, and safe, with plenty of staff around to assist.
